Writer: Patrick Sheane Duncan (Screenplay)
Starring: Richard Dreyfuss, Glenne Headly, Jay Thomas, Olympia Dukakis, William H Macy, Alicia Witt, Terrence Howard, Damon Whitaker, Jean Louise Kelly
Plot: A frustrated composer finds fulfilment as a high school music teacher.
